Insomnia has created an urge for me to spew my thoughts.
Advice I wish I would have known before I hiked the PCT:
1) When Meadow Ed tells you all about the Pink Motel at Lake Morena,
write down somewhere exactly where it is, which brings us to
point 2.....
2) DO NOT SIT UNDER I-10 FOR 4 HOURS waiting for things to cool off.
That is assuming the fine folks at the Pink Motel are once again
taking in hikers. The grafitti just ain't that entertaining.
3) PCT Literature seems to be anti-hitching. I realized this as I was
hiking towards the side trail to Big Bear. Looking at my map I
realized "I'm going to cross a busy road on the trail, Hey! that
road goes to town". A few minutes using the thumb avoided walking
the extra mileage along the trail all the books tell you to take. I
noticed a similar situation for Wrightwood too although I think
sometimes the road that goes to town and that hikers seem to cross
57,000 times is closed.
That's all that leaps to mind for now.
